Waylon Smeathers is the Manager of Pole Attachment Services at CPS Energy, where he oversees programs that support the safe and efficient deployment of communications infrastructure on the utility’s distribution system. His role focuses on joint use operations, process improvement, regulatory compliance, and collaboration with telecommunications providers. Waylon has over ten years of experience overseeing pole attachments from an electric utility perspective. Prior to joining CPS Energy, he held various roles in the joint use department for an investor owned utility.

Utilities as Infrastructure Partners: New Rules for Make-Ready in 2026

Real World Best Practices in Developing, Negotiating, and Implementing Infrastructure Access Agreements with Utilities From pole attachment agreements to fiber lease agreements building, maintaining, and extending facilities-based broadband networks often involves a need to access utility or other third-party infrastructure. Increasingly, utilities are partners in these projects. This session will address best practices for developing and managing these agreements in a constructive and mutually beneficial manner. The session will explore:

  • The scope of current and new federal pole attachment make-ready regulations;
  • Key issues and considerations for successfully addressing bulk deployments in previously unserved areas;
  • Managing carrier and utility expectations;
  • Utilities as participants in public private broadband partnerships.
